Head over Heels: Falls and How to Prevent Them
This video outlines ways in which older adults can prevent falls. The prevention of falls is extremely important to older adults because they often face long term consequences from falls. The video is divided into four sections each of which explains some of the reasons for falls and ways to reduce the chances of falling. Head Over Heels is accompanied by a helpful 16 page booklet reinforcing the points in the video.

Substance Abuse in The Elderly
Faced with complex regimens of medication and diminished tolerances for alcohol, many elderly Americans run the risk of falling into the trap of substance abuse. In this program, senior citizens discuss how they deal with these challenges, while Dr. James Campbell, director of the geriatric center at the MetroHealth Center, and Carol Colleran Egan, director of the older adult services for Hanley-Hazleden Center, present some innovative prevention programs created especially for elderly people.

Unpaid Caregivers

According to reports from state, local and federal government agencies; family caregivers are responsible for contributing an estimated $257 Billion dollars, annually, in free, unpaid care for a loved one. You'd think this contribution to society would at least provide a tax break, wouldn't you? Or perhaps a Thank You card?

Seventeen percent of caregivers say they provide 40 or more hours of care per week. Sixty-two percent of family members, typically the adult daughter, juggle their caregiving duties around their jobs and careers. Thirty nine percent of care providers are men, the adult son. This number has risen from nineteen percent some ten years ago. Clearly, the adult daughter remains the primary care provider for her family, averaging sixty percent of all family providers.
